**Service Account: cron-audit**

While reviewing the drift investigation branch, note that the `cron-audit` account queries the Tickwright scheduler's internal timing API to compare expected versus actual fire times. The patch adds a five-minute tolerance window. To reproduce the drift report locally, call the timing API with the key below.

API key for yahig-tadup: kto7_ubizbYm

Management Meeting Minutes — Joint Venture Discussion

Hi — quick minutes for the incoming director. We reviewed the joint venture proposal from Aldenmoor Technics covering the Pellworth sensor line. General mood: cautiously positive. Agreed next steps: due diligence by month-end, revenue split modeling, and a site visit to their Fenwick facility. Full decision deferred to next session. One point stays confidential.

management briefing: Project Ulavan slips by two quarters because of the staffing delay.

**Ticket #889 — Revisit permessage-deflate on Channeline sockets**

Heads up for the security review: we enabled websocket compression on the Channeline relay to cut bandwidth, but now we're worried about compression-oracle style leaks when user input shares a frame with session state. Options are disabling deflate entirely, splitting sensitive fields into separate frames, or per-message context resets (slower, safer). Bandwidth savings were ~40%, so disabling hurts. Flagging for your call. Repro build token follows for reference.

pipeline stamp: htk6_35e0c9

## Further Reading

Tilewarden, our map-tile prefetcher, has a few quirks worth knowing before Thursday's sync — especially the way it prioritizes tiles along predicted routes and evicts stale zoom levels. The cache-sizing math changed last sprint, so old notes are out of date. The current design doc, benchmarks, and open questions are collected on the internal page below.

wiki page, bagaf-fawip: https://harbor.tolvaqsys.local/pages/repo/pages/secrets/eac969ffc71f356b